Roadwork on Stanford Road begins Monday, March 18

Posted

The Town of Paradise Valley’s pavement preservation project will move on to Stanford Road starting Monday, March 18.

The two-phase process will start with crack sealing operations followed by an application of surface seal, according to the Town Manager’s Weekly Update. Work at Stanford Road is estimated for completion on Saturday, March 30 with temporary striping. Inclement weather may cause delays to the construction schedule.

Traffic delays should be expected when flagman setups will restrict travel down to one lane, the newsletter stated. Be prepared to stop and use extra caution in construction zones. Delays will occur at residential driveways adjacent to Stanford Road when surface seal product is applied.

Town representatives will be onsite throughout the entirety of the project to ensure residents can inquire about access to property or scheduling questions. If you have questions, please call the MR Tanner onsite project manager Josh Lansford at 480-486-9067.
